Description

The Douglas II is a one-story home offering three bedrooms, two full bathrooms, and a two-car garage. The open-concept layout connects the kitchen to the great room, creating a spacious and bright central living space. A private primary suite offers comfort and seclusion, while an oversized laundry room and a large, covered lanai enhance everyday functionality and outdoor living. Thoughtful design details, abundant natural light, and generous storage complete this home's perfect blend of style and convenience.

Community Description

Ashton Woods has built a reputation for creating exceptionally designed, inspired homes in the most desirable communities. Here, tucked away near the heart of historic Mount Dora and Lake Dora, you'll find a collection of single-family homes in Trailside. Experience the local history and enjoy the convenience of top-rated schools, Orlando's work centers, eateries and adventures. Start the day with a refreshing round of golf on one of five scenic local courses. Lace up your boots and adventure through the lush trails of Kelly Park and afterward, cool off with a dip in the natural spring's swimming and tubing areas. On the weekends, boat around Lake County's 130 miles of waterways. Stroll through downtown Mount Dora admiring the elaborate architecture, charming streets and boutique shops. Enjoy a sunset dinner at one of the many outdoor restaurants before topping off the evening with a show at the local theatre. Back in Trailside, take the kids to the playground in the morning. Meet neighbors in the clubhouse in the afternoon for fun and games. Relax with friends on sunny afternoons by the pool and spend a quiet evening under the stars on your front porch. Explore Trailside and discover thoughtfully designed homes created for the memories you'll make inside.
